Radiology Technician: Unveiling the Role

A radiology technician, often referred to as a radiologic technologist, is a medical professional responsible for performing diagnostic imaging examinations, including X-rays, CT scans, and MRIs. Their expertise in operating imaging equipment and ensuring patient comfort makes them indispensable members of the healthcare team. But what does it take to become a proficient radiology technician?

Education and Training: Building the Foundation

Becoming a skilled radiology technician requires a blend of formal education and hands-on training. Most technicians pursue an associate's degree in radiologic technology, which covers subjects like anatomy, patient care, radiation protection, and image evaluation. Some programs even offer specializations in areas like mammography or computed tomography (CT).

Gaining Expertise: Clinical Experience and Licensure

While classroom learning is essential, hands-on experience is equally crucial for a radiology technician's development. Clinical rotations provide aspiring technicians with the opportunity to practice imaging techniques under supervision, refining their skills and adapting to real-world scenarios. After completing an accredited program, technicians often need to obtain a state license, demonstrating their competence and commitment to patient safety.

Radiation Safety: Paramount Concerns

As a radiology technician, working with ionizing radiation is part of the job. Consequently, maintaining strict radiation safety protocols is non-negotiable. Technicians must ensure that both patients and themselves are shielded from unnecessary radiation exposure, emphasizing the significance of precision and attention to detail in positioning patients and using lead aprons and shields.

Career Pathways: Beyond the Basics

Radiology technicians can explore various career pathways based on their expertise and interests. Some technicians specialize in certain imaging modalities, such as magnetic resonance imaging (MRI) or ultrasound. Others may pursue roles in education, research, or even healthcare administration, leveraging their technical knowledge and experience in diverse ways.

Art of Patient Care: Communication Matters

While technical proficiency is vital, the art of patient care is equally significant. Radiology technicians often interact directly with patients, explaining procedures, allaying concerns, and ensuring their comfort throughout the imaging process. Compassion, effective communication, and a reassuring demeanor can make a significant difference in a patient's experience.

Advancements in Technology: Staying Ahead

The field of radiology is in a state of constant evolution, with technological advancements shaping the way diagnostic imaging is performed. Radiology technicians must stay updated on the latest equipment and software, adapting their skills to new technologies like 3D imaging, digital radiography, and AI-assisted diagnostics.

Collaborative Healthcare: Teamwork in Radiology

Radiology technicians don't work in isolation; they are integral to a collaborative healthcare ecosystem. They collaborate with radiologists, nurses, and other medical professionals to ensure accurate diagnoses and seamless patient care. Effective teamwork and clear communication are essential for delivering comprehensive medical insights.

Radiology Technician FAQs

What's the Difference Between a Radiology Technician and a Radiologist?

While both roles involve medical imaging, a radiology technician operates the imaging equipment and performs the scans, while a radiologist interprets the images and makes diagnoses.

How Long Does It Take to Become a Radiology Technician?

The journey to becoming a radiology technician typically takes about two to four years, including education, clinical training, and licensure.

Is Radiation Exposure a Concern for Radiology Technicians?

Radiation exposure is a concern, but strict safety measures, such as lead shielding and distance from the radiation source, help minimize the risks for technicians.

What Skills Are Essential for a Radiology Technician?

Key skills include technical proficiency in operating imaging equipment, attention to detail, communication skills, and the ability to remain calm under pressure.

Can Radiology Technicians Specialize in Specific Imaging Techniques?

Yes, radiology technicians can specialize in various imaging modalities like MRI, CT scans, mammography, and more, enhancing their expertise in a particular area.

How Is Patient Interaction a Part of a Radiology Technician's Role?

Patient interaction involves explaining procedures, addressing concerns, and ensuring patients are at ease during imaging examinations.
